Output f3bb71f58c419fb005a86da2bca9ee2ab356894a89dca4ced2ddb4121d8b83ab:1

value
54667825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 921dde889078fc3b2d66c6df7109f48872f30e95 OP_EQUAL
address
3F1cMuQUyAYrUShtvt3nYJZnwM7Ghok7yP
transaction
f3bb71f58c419fb005a86da2bca9ee2ab356894a89dca4ced2ddb4121d8b83ab
confirmations
328097
spent
true